act of turning on and off the KPA1500 or KPA500 should not change the power in the K3 or K4. Changing the amp from STBY to OPER should cause that change assuming the K3/K4 has the proper configuration. Did you switch the KPA150 to OPER? 73, Jack, W6FB > On Oct 20, 2024, at 1:18 PM, Carl Yaffe
